So what if gamers, including the casual ones, ultimately grow tired of Wii's limited graphics and processing power in just two to three years? Analyst Michael Pachter says not to overlook Nintendo's ability to abandon the standard five year life cycle when it comes to releasing a Wii successor.

"Consumers may hope for improved graphics, and my guess is that Nintendo will comply," he says. "In two or three years, commodity prices for graphics processors and CPUs may decline to the point that a High Definition Wii could be introduced. If so, Nintendo will likely introduce one."
That is more possible than some people may think or even realize, as to my knowledge both Sony and MS took a nice big bite of that profit loss sandwich to push there console sales, while Nintendo has made a profit from every Wii they've sold.

This is great news and like many others here I think there is a decent chance that the Wii will overtake the PS2 in total console sales over the course of its lifetime.

My only concern would be regarding software sales. Many of us are more traditional gamers, so this doesn’t really apply, but given the market that Nintendo has gone after (ie the non-gamers) I’d say there is a pretty good chance that average game sales per console owner will be lower than with some other consoles.

And before anyone flames me I’d just like to say that I have had a Wii since launch day and have 7 games plus 4 controllers and 4 nunchucks so I’m totally sold on the Wii, I just think that there is a long way to go in this ‘war’ and the people who have bought the console who aren’t hard-core gamers are probably less likely to buy lots of games.
